Gerst, Marvin S.; Sweetwood, Hervey – Environment and Behavior, 1973
This study sampled 198 studentsin seven dormitories and 55 suites in an effort to elucidate the relationsh ip between social environment as measured by the University Residence Environment Scales, and subject mood states, friendship patterns, and perception of the architecture of dormitories. (JP)

Bickman, Leonard; And Others – Environment and Behavior, 1973
Investigated was the relationship between dormitory density and attitudes of residents. Students in higher-density dormitories were less trusting, cooperative and friendly than students in lower-density dormitories. The implications of these relults for planners and architects were discussed. (JP)
